SHRIMP FRANCESE
Butterflied shrimp are dipped in flour and egg, then pan-seared until browned on the outside and tender and juicy inside. A quick, buttery white wine sauce and wilted baby spinach complete this easy, elegant dish.

Steps:
- Butterfly the shrimp: Make a deep cut along the outer curved edge of a shrimp, then spread open like a book. Repeat with the remaining shrimp. Pat dry.
- Whisk the eggs with 1 teaspoon salt, 1/2 teaspoon pepper and 1 tablespoon parsley in a bowl. Heat about 1/8 inch ol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Put the flour in a shallow bowl. Working in batches, dredge the shrimp in the flour, dip in the egg mixture and add to the skillet cut-side down; fry, turning, until lightly browned, about 3 minutes. Transfer to paper towels to drain.
- Pour out any oil from the skillet and wipe clean. Add the broth, wine and lemon juice and b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Add the tomatoes and cook until the sauce is slightly reduced, about 4 minutes. Push the tomatoes to one side; whisk in the butter a few pieces at a time. Stir in the shrimp and the remaining 1 tablespoon parsley.
- Meanwhile, put the spinach in a microwave-safe bowl, sprinkle with water and season with salt and pepper. Cover with plastic wrap and pierce the plastic; microwave until wilted, 3 to 5 minutes. Divide the spinach and shrimp mixture among plates and top with the sauce.

MARINATED SHRIMP WITH CHAMPAGNE BEURRE BLANC

Steps:
- For sauce base:
- Combine Champagne, shallots, vinegar, and peppercorns in heavy medium saucepan. Boil until reduced to 1/4 cup liquid, about 20 minutes. (Can be made 4 hours ahead. Cover and let stand at room temperature.)
- For shrimp:
- Combine Champagne, olive oil, shallots, and ground pepper in resealable plastic bag. Add shrimp to bag and seal; shake bag to coat shrimp evenly. Marinate shrimp at room temperature at least 30 minutes and up to 1 hour, turning bag occasionally. Mix chives, tarragon, and parsley in small bowl.
- Preheat broiler. Spray broiler pan with nonstick vegetable oil spray. Drain shrimp; discard plastic bag with marinade. Arrange shrimp on prepared pan in single layer. Broil shrimp until just opaque in center, about 2 minutes per side. Stand 3 shrimp, tails upright, in center of each plate.
- Rewarm sauce base over medium-low heat. Whisk in butter 1 piece at a time, just allowing each to melt before adding next (do not boil or sauce will separate). Season beurre blanc to taste with salt and pepper.
- Spoon warm sauce around shrimp. Sprinkle with fresh herbs and serve.

CREAMY GARLIC SHRIMP TOAST
Sweet, butterflied shrimp in a garlicky cream sauce with a smoky paprika flavor are served over thick slices of buttery, pan-toasted French bread in this simple recipe for two! This sauce would be good over pasta, rice, or potatoes, but I think enjoying it like this is the best way to go.

Steps:
- Butterfly shrimp and place in a mixing bowl. Add cayenne, paprika, and garlic and stir until shrimp are evenly coated. Refrigerate until needed.
- Trim most of the crusts off of the bread.
- Add 4 tablespoons melted butter to a skillet over medium heat. Add both slices of bread and toast until golden brown, 3 to 4 minutes per side. Remove bread to a plate and wipe out any crumbs.
- Add remaining melted butter to the skillet and increase heat to high. When the pan is very hot and you see the first wisp of smoke, add shrimp and use tongs to spread into an even layer. Sear, without stirring or tossing, for 1 minute.
- Sprinkle with lemon zest and add lemon juice and cream. Stir with a spoon to scrape any browned bits off the bottom. Let cream boil and reduce for 1 ½ to 2 minutes as the shrimp finishes cooking and the sauce thickens up.
- Turn off the heat and stir in parsley. Taste and add salt if needed.
- Divide shrimp and sauce evenly over each piece of toasted bread.
